Waves of Change for Autism
Waves of Changes for Autism is a nonprofit organization based in Vaughan that supports individuals on the autism spectrum and their families. It provides resources, funding assistance, and community programs aimed at improving access to therapies and developmental support. The organization focuses on inclusion, empowerment, and advocacy, working to create a more supportive and understanding environment for individuals with autism.

Vaughan Food Bank
Founded in 1995, the Vaughan Food Bank has been dedicated to serving Vaughan and surrounding communities in York Region. Under the leadership of Peter Wixon, it’s run entirely by passionate volunteers who generously give their time, and it relies on the kindness of local businesses and individuals through their generous support. The Food Bank is a testament to the community’s spirit and generosity.
